Output d8a50f1d9e99a0144a46a660c68412e75db9915489ff0d66d50a75a0feec6546:106

value
35396828
script pubkey
OP_0 OP_PUSHBYTES_20 3c4ec14b3dd213d27099329f560243dad2ec2f07
address
bc1q838vzjea6gfayuyex204vqjrmtfwctc8en5mhd
transaction
d8a50f1d9e99a0144a46a660c68412e75db9915489ff0d66d50a75a0feec6546